Meaning

The United Kingdom electric vehicle battery anode market refers to the comprehensive ecosystem encompassing the production, distribution, and application of anode materials specifically designed for electric vehicle batteries within the UK territory. An anode serves as the negative electrode in lithium-ion batteries, playing a crucial role in energy storage and release during charging and discharging cycles.

Battery anode materials are fundamental components that determine the performance characteristics of electric vehicle batteries, including energy density, charging speed, cycle life, and overall safety. The market includes various anode technologies ranging from traditional graphite-based solutions to advanced silicon composites and next-generation materials that promise enhanced performance capabilities.

Market scope encompasses the entire value chain from raw material sourcing and processing to manufacturing, quality control, and integration into complete battery systems. This includes domestic production facilities, import operations, research and development activities, and the supporting infrastructure required to meet the growing demand from UK-based electric vehicle manufacturers and battery producers.

Competitive Landscape

Market leadership in the UK electric vehicle battery anode market features a combination of established international companies and emerging domestic players focused on innovative technologies and specialized applications.

  1. Johnson Matthey – Leading UK-based company with strong capabilities in advanced battery materials and established relationships with automotive manufacturers
  2. Nexeon Limited – British silicon anode technology specialist developing next-generation materials for high-performance applications
  3. Faradion – UK sodium-ion battery technology company with innovative anode material solutions for specific market segments
  4. AMTE Power – British battery manufacturer with integrated anode material capabilities serving automotive and energy storage markets
  5. Ilika – UK solid-state battery technology developer with advanced anode material research and development capabilities
  6. Britishvolt – Major UK battery manufacturing initiative with plans for integrated anode material production capabilities

Category-wise Insights

Automotive category dominates the UK electric vehicle battery anode market, representing the largest and most dynamic segment with substantial growth potential. This category benefits from strong government support, increasing consumer acceptance, and major manufacturer commitments to electrification. The automotive segment drives demand for high-performance anode materials that can deliver superior range, fast charging, and long cycle life.

Energy storage category represents a rapidly expanding market segment driven by the UK’s renewable energy transition and grid modernization initiatives. This category requires anode materials optimized for stationary applications, with emphasis on cycle life, safety, and cost-effectiveness rather than energy density optimization.

Commercial vehicle category is emerging as a significant growth driver, with applications in electric buses, delivery vehicles, and heavy-duty transportation. This category demands robust anode materials capable of handling high power requirements and frequent charging cycles associated with commercial vehicle operations.

Marine and aerospace categories represent specialized market segments with unique performance requirements and regulatory standards. These categories offer opportunities for premium anode materials with exceptional performance characteristics, though market volumes remain relatively limited compared to automotive applications.

Consumer electronics category maintains steady demand for anode materials, though growth rates are modest compared to automotive and energy storage segments. This category emphasizes miniaturization, safety, and cost optimization for portable device applications.

Market Key Trends

Silicon integration trend represents the most significant development in anode technology, with silicon-enhanced anodes gaining widespread adoption due to their superior energy density compared to traditional graphite materials. This trend is driving substantial research and development investments as companies seek to overcome technical challenges associated with silicon expansion during charging cycles.
